What to Pack for Your Dog's Stay at Our Pet Ranch
Essential Items for Your Dog's Comfort
When preparing for your dog's stay at our pet ranch, ensuring their comfort is key. Start with their favorite bed or blanket. Familiar scents can ease anxiety and make their stay more enjoyable. Additionally, pack a few toys that your dog loves to play with. Whether it's a squeaky toy or a chew bone, these items keep them engaged and happy.

Don't forget to bring along any specialized feeding bowls your pet may need. Some dogs have dietary requirements that necessitate specific types of bowls, such as slow feeders. Including these ensures that your dog's meal times are as comfortable and stress-free as possible.
Food and Treats
It's important to maintain your dog's regular diet during their stay. Pack enough of their usual food to last the entire duration. Include instructions on feeding times and portion sizes to help us provide the best care. Bringing some of their favorite treats can also be a great way to reward good behavior and keep them content.

If your dog is on a special diet, make sure to label all food containers clearly and provide detailed instructions. This is crucial for maintaining your pet's health and ensuring they have a smooth and enjoyable stay with us.
Health and Safety Essentials
Your dog's health and safety are our top priorities. Please bring any medications they may be taking, along with clear dosage instructions. This ensures that we can administer them correctly and on time. It's also beneficial to pack a copy of their vaccination records in case of emergencies.

A collar with an ID tag is essential for safety. Ensure it has your current contact information, so we can reach you if necessary. Additionally, if your dog uses a safety harness or special leash, include those in your packing list.
Personal Comfort Items
For dogs that wear clothing, pack their favorite outfits, especially if they're prone to feeling cold or have skin sensitivities. This can help them feel more at home and comfortable during their stay.

If your dog is used to a specific grooming routine, consider including grooming tools like brushes or pet wipes. Keeping up with grooming can help reduce stress and maintain their wellbeing while they're away from home.
Final Checklist
To ensure you haven't missed anything, here's a checklist you can follow:
- Bedding and blankets
- Toys and comfort items
- Food, treats, and feeding bowls
- Medications and vaccination records
- Collar with ID tag
- Safety harness or leash
- Clothing and grooming tools
